Pan-Am, Boeing 737-200:

[ img ]
In the early 80's Pan-Am leased or bought sixteen second-hand 737-200s to replace older 727-100 the airline owned or got after its acquisition of National Airlines. Most of those 737-200 were either returned to their owner or retired in the late 80s and replaced by used 727-200s. Three were still with the airline when it went bankrupt in late 1991.
